    roe deer

    As sika are herding deer they adapt well to being kept in parks or enclosures, even quite small ones. It's perfectly feasible to suggest that a small group of sika could have escaped from a park, almost all feral deer populations started this way with the exeption of a few deliberate releases...

    roe deer

    The only deer spp in the UK that can interbreed are red and sika as they are both of the genus cervus. It's interesting that you say that you originally thought there were sika there, one thing that we teach students is to listen to your first impression then use the evidence to prove or...
